ED raids Lovely Professional University in Punjab, owned by Ashok Kumar Mittal who replaced Raghav Chadha in Rajya Sabha
The Enforcement Directorate on Wednesday carried out raids at the campus of Lovely Professional University in Phagwara, along with multiple premises linked to the Lovely Group owned by AAP Rajya Sabha MP Ashok Kumar Mittal.
The searches were conducted by ED teams from Jalandhar and Chandigarh as part of a probe into alleged violations of the Foreign Exchange Management Act. Officials said the action targeted business entities associated with the Lovely Group, including the residence of Mittal.
Apart from the university campus, the agency also searched institutions such as Tetr College of Business and Masters’ Union College of Business in Gurugram, along with other establishments owned by the group, including sweets shops, auto businesses and a distance education centre.
Ashok Mittal, founder and chancellor of LPU, owns the group along with his brothers Ramesh Mittal and Naresh Mittal. The raids come days after he was elevated to the post of Rajya Sabha deputy leader of the Aam Aadmi Party, replacing Raghav Chadha.
Reacting to the development, senior AAP leaders accused the BJP-led Centre of using central agencies for political purposes ahead of elections in Punjab. Former Delhi chief minister Arvind Kejriwal said the move signalled the start of poll preparations, while Punjab chief minister Bhagwant Mann also criticised the raids, calling them a “typical” tactic.
The ED has not sought assistance from local police, and the searches began early Wednesday morning, officials said.
